Entertaining
This is a movie that delivers exactly what I expected - a kid's movie. This is a movie the whole family can enjoy. The plot: A young girl (Maddy) finds out her father is dying from an illness that only an experimental operation can cure. When she discovers that the operation cost more than her parents can afford, she makes a bad decision to steal the money from one of her mother's clients.
Maddy makes bad decision after bad decision, but I think in the end she learns from her mistakes; and it is that fact that makes the message of the movie okay by me.
I think this movie had unique characters and a very interesting plot. There were a few bad actors though; the head security guard at the bank building may have turned in the worst performance I have seen in quite a few years.
Kristen Stewart is an amazing actress, and I see her as a young Jodie Foster. She is going to be a huge star! Corbin Bleu and Max Thierot were flawless in their roles as Maddy's best friends.
The critics of this film need to realize that most Americans are sick of the "Kill Bill" and "Lost in Translation" type movies. It seems the more gore or negative-thinking is thrown in to a movie, the more chances it has of being adored by the Hollywood elite. I think it is time to make movies that can rely on substance and acting. This movie is not in the same league as Tombstone or Lord of the Rings, but it definitely delivers everything it claims to deliver in the synopsis!
